Output 5c59ec7f1063ffe283f93ae907cdaace606010cdbca120897b2f368009825878:0

value
681057
script pubkey
OP_0 OP_PUSHBYTES_32 ad1ccac7260f0bca926bd653cdff5155be369384e4987fbf3e8b3c3ff0695f54
address
bc1q45wv43expu9u4ynt6efuml632klrdyuyujv8l0e73v7rlurfta2qmtfdc7
transaction
5c59ec7f1063ffe283f93ae907cdaace606010cdbca120897b2f368009825878
confirmations
30694
spent
true